As a courtesy to reviewers, it is helpful to provide a pointer to the
previous submission to give context for the new submission. For
instance, like this [1].

Several fixups of the t9138-git-svn-authors-prog.sh test script to
follow current recommendations in t/README.
- Fixed a Perl script with a full #!/usr/bin/perl shebang
to use write_script() and $PERL_PATH as per t/README.
- Placed svn-authors data setup inside a test_expect_success.
